I have found a Trial for Larceny of a George Redman in Sussex, 28th November 1838. He was found Not guilty. His age is given as 38 making his DOB 1800. The birth date of my Gt x 2 Grandfather who lived in Sussex is 1800. . I have printed out the pages of the court record book. I am wondering if there is any way to find out any more details or even if there would be more to find? Where the Court was or where he lived. I did try TNA but nothing came up for me . I just did a general search for George Redman putting year 1838.

George Redman, cordwainer, 38, was charged with stealing two ducks at Poynings on 23 October, the property of Wm Thacker, landlord of the Dyke Inn ( Brighton Gazette 29 November 1838, page 3).
It was the Lewes Adlourned Sessions
-
There's a very detailed report of the committal hearing in the Brighton Patriot of 30 October 1838, page 3 column 2.
